Sebastian Thrun is an academic researcher from Stanford University. The author has contributed to research in topics: Mobile robot & Robot. The author has an hindex of 146, co-authored 434 publications receiving 98124 citations. Previous affiliations of Sebastian Thrun include University of Pittsburgh & ETH Zurich.
